Flutter

[Flutter] The caller does not have permission to execute the specified operation. 오류 확인하기

사과씨앗 2023. 11. 5. 16:40
728x90
반응형

 

firebase 적용 후 앱을 실행시켜보니 아래 같은 오류가 호출되었다.

 

[VERBOSE-2:dart_vm_initializer.cc(41)] Unhandled Exception: [cloud_firestore/permission-denied] The caller does not have permission to execute the specified operation.
#0      FirebaseFirestoreHostApi.queryGet (package:cloud_firestore_platform_interface/src/pigeon/messages.pigeon.dart:1057:7)
<asynchronous suspension>
#1      MethodChannelQuery.get (package:cloud_firestore_platform_interface/src/method_channel/method_channel_query.dart:116:11)
<asynchronous suspension>
#2      _JsonQuery.get (package:cloud_firestore/src/query.dart:397:9)

 

권한이 없다는 말인거 같아서 firebase 콘솔에서 찾아보던 중 console의 규칙탭을 확인하라고 하는 글을 보고 들어가 보니

 

 

false 값을 true 로 변경한 다음 게시 하니 오류 없이 잘 실행된다.

728x90
반응형